Early Life and Education

Andy Bean, a talented TV actor, was born on July 10, 1984, in Chicago, Illinois. Growing up, his family settled in Mount Prospect, and he spent his formative years in Carrollton, Texas. His passion for acting was evident from a young age, leading him to pursue formal training in theater.

Bean enrolled in the renowned Quad C Theatre program at Collin County Community College in Plano, Texas. This experience shaped his skills and laid the foundation for a successful acting career. Rise to Fame

Bean's breakthrough came when he landed the role of Greg Knox in the hit series Power. His portrayal of the character earned him recognition and praise from audiences and critics alike. He showcased his versatility as an actor by taking on diverse roles in both TV and film.

In addition to his role in Power, Bean made a memorable appearance as Henry in HBO's short-lived series Here and Now. He also portrayed Alec Holland in DC Universe's Swamp Thing, showcasing his range and ability to bring complex characters to life on screen. On the big screen, he impressed audiences with his performance as Stanley Uris in It: Chapter Two.

Notable Projects

Bean's talent and dedication have not gone unnoticed in the industry. He secured a minor role in the 2017 blockbuster Transformers: The Last Knight, further establishing himself as a versatile actor capable of tackling various genres and roles.
